Output 266e68adb752dea9df03f0566da384d9751d1cd1849d90b4901e4da31ebd227e:123

value
28790
script pubkey
OP_0 OP_PUSHBYTES_20 2f504fa41ae0e0a8b450b5e1a5022f4a31f16ec3
address
bc1q9agylfq6urs23dzskhs62q30fgclzmkrst5hfg
transaction
266e68adb752dea9df03f0566da384d9751d1cd1849d90b4901e4da31ebd227e